Playland park charges 7 dollars admission plus 75 crnts per ride. Funland park charges 12.50$ admission plus 50 cents per ride. For what number of rides is the total cost the same at both parks?​

Answer:

22 rides

Explanation:

Both the parks has a fixed cost (admission fee) and a variable cost (per ride cost). We can model 2 equations in "x" [let x be number of rides], equate them and find "x".

Playland Park:

Fixed Cost = 7

Variable Cost = 0.75x (in dollars)

Equation = 7 + 0.75x

Funland Park:

Fixed Cost = 12.50

Variable Cost = 0.50x (in dollars)

Equation = 12.50 + 0.50x

Now we equate and solve for x:


7+0.75x=12.50 + 0.50x\\0.75x-0.50x=12.50-7\\0.25x=5.50\\x=(5.50)/(0.25)\\x=22

Hence,

the cost would be same for both parks for 22 rides
